Output 69c84fc2c61150261eecb5d4a203b81dd8c57d0786553e3bea1eedacfc636c44:0

value
69949437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a849490308b58f16c32f42137588fc1e2085f3aa OP_EQUAL
address
MPEyYbvCp79TRtCa5VTQHsBv81T5Ue7Qqt
transaction
69c84fc2c61150261eecb5d4a203b81dd8c57d0786553e3bea1eedacfc636c44
spent
true